The Best HVAC Tips For Pet Owners

While owning a pet is fun for the whole family, the impacts that it can have on your air conditioning and heating units are brutal. Fur, dander and dirt all can clog your vents! This means that your AC system is going to have to work harder to get around the dander that your pet leaves behind. Whether it’s a cat, a dog or a gerbil, there are a few key ways to protect your HVAC from unnecessary strain!

Get Covers For Your Outdoor Units

The outdoor unit of your air conditioning system is one of the most important parts. This is because it facilitates the movement of air from the outside to the inside, always providing fresh, filtered air. If you keep your pets outside, like many cats or dogs are, making sure they don’t sit on the unit is crucial. This is also because the fur and dander can clog the filter, which will damage the outside unit over time.

Getting a cover for your outdoor unit has a lot of benefits, but mostly protects the AC from fur or waste from animals. This will prevent the inhalation of toxic fumes or allergens that may spread through the air, as well as protecting the wires and tubes from biting.

Get A Stronger Air Purification System

Stronger air purification materials can be a huge help in making sure pet dander doesn’t have too much of an impact on the way that your AC operates. Air purification options for pet fur and dander include:

  • HEPA Air Filters
  • UV Air Purifiers
  • Activated Carbon Filters
  • Ionic Air Purifiers
  • Air Purifying Plants
  • Portable Air Filters

Using one or more of these can reduce the amount of pet dander and other allergens that are in your home, which is better for your health and your air conditioning. Keeping your home clean and vacuuming often will also reduce it, but mixed with a strong air purification system, the change can be drastic!

Performing AC Maintenance With Pets

Performing maintenance with a pet in the household looks a little bit different. While making sure to clean your vents and your unit is important already, it becomes even more important with the presence of pet dander. Cleaning out your vents can be a process, but its super important to do it at least once every two weeks.

To clean your vents, turn your HVAC system off entirely and remove the vent covers. This is important as it gives you the most access to the vents. Clean the vent covers with warm, soapy water to remove any build-up. Then, you can vacuum out your ducts using the hose attachment on your vacuum cleaner to remove any dirt, debris and pet dander.

During this time, you can also change the air filter or do any other maintenance that you would usually do during this time. Changing the air filter when you clean out your vents, especially with pet dander, is super beneficial as it makes sure that there is no clogging.

How Many Air Conditioning Tune-Ups Should I Schedule If I Have Pets?

Tune-ups are extremely important if you have a pet in the house. While you can do basic cleaning by yourself, having an HVAC technician visit at least once a year will identify and fix any issues. During these tune-ups, your technician will be able to evaluate whether your pet has done a significant amount of damage to your AC parts.

The absolute best amount of tune-ups you can get per year is two, once before winter and once before summer. This is the time that your heating and air conditioning will be used the most, making it important to schedule before those times for optimum performance.
